Taking a practical project as the study system, this paper establishes a modified dynamic model by modifying the current switching function, firing angle calculation and DC voltage calculation. Then, the accuracy of the modified model is verified by a detailed electromagnetic transient (EMT) simulation. Finally, with the modified dynamic model, the impact of the control parameters and AC system strength on the small-signal stability of the overall system is investigated by adopting the eigen-analysis. The results clearly demonstrate that the modified model shows higher accuracy than the original model. UR - https://doi.org/10.17775/CSEEJPES.2021.05820 DO - 10.17775/CSEEJPES.2021.05820
